It's a completely different evolution of Lutheranism from the LCMS and WELS. Also, the Episcopal Church has … Web4 jan. 2024 · One type of church polity is episcopal. The word episcopal is from the Greek word episkopos, which is often translated in English as “bishop” or “overseer.”. This form of church government functions with a single leader, often called a bishop. The Roman Catholic Church may be the most well-known of the episcopal-type churches. high meadow pet crematory

Web28 mrt. 2015 · Whereas Pentecostals (e.g., AoG, Foursquare) lean in the direction of doctrine, charismatics are far more interested in experience and behavioral markers. A mainline (or evangelical) congregation may have cliques of charismatics within it who meet in small groups together. high meadow homes for sale
